Bonuses: Read Beyond the Headline
Promotions can increase a bankroll, but the advertised amount rarely tells the complete story. A welcome package may include a deposit match, free spins, or a combination of rewards. Each component can carry different minimum deposits, maximum bonus values, and wagering requirements.
- Confirm whether the promotion applies to your country and payment method.
- Check the minimum deposit and the maximum amount eligible for matching.
- Review the wagering multiplier and which games contribute to it.
- Look for maximum bet restrictions while bonus funds are active.
- Note the expiry period and any rules for withdrawing before completion.
Players should calculate the practical value of a promotion rather than treating the headline figure as guaranteed cash. A smaller offer with transparent conditions may be more useful than a larger package with a demanding rollover. Promotional rules can change, so the current terms displayed at registration should take priority over older reviews or advertisements.
Payments, Security, and Verification
Banking is one of the clearest indicators of an operator’s convenience. Before depositing, compare the listed methods, minimum and maximum transaction amounts, processing estimates, and possible charges. Deposits are often instant, while withdrawals may require additional review, particularly for a first request.
Identity verification is a normal part of regulated online gambling. The casino may request documents confirming identity, address, or ownership of a payment method. Submitting clear, valid documents through the official secure process can reduce delays. Players should never send sensitive information through unverified social media accounts or unfamiliar links.
Security also includes account habits. Use a unique password, enable any available authentication feature, and avoid saving login details on shared devices. A trustworthy platform should explain its privacy approach and provide visible support channels for account or payment questions.
